Saftey Notes

- DON’T RUN OTHER LARGE TOOLS WHILE CNC MACHINE IS RUNNING (the machine is very susceptible to power fluctuations- unexpected results may occur and can be dangerous)

- Always check Zero and home positions before running a part

- Edge guards are in place (especially if using down-cut bits) - incase a bit breaks and fly's off. Don't want that bit to hit anyone (or break more car glass - oops!)

- Be sure to use a sacrificial board when needed

- Safety glasses!

- Hearing protection!

- Be award of clamps or other things that can come into contact with router and gantry

- Be aware of the current bit's max cutting depth and depth required to cut / clearances

- If cutting out a part be sure part has tall enough tabs for material setup so pieces don’t fly out when cutting.

- when cutting out a deep part – consider using pocket cut to cut out larger than the bit to avoid binding and breaking the bit down in a deep hole

- TABS- be sure to make them big enough and account for cutting deeper than the material!!
